### Step 4: Enable log compaction on Quillbus

After the broker upgrade completes, turn on compaction for the `orders-state` topic so the queue stops growing unbounded. Compaction keeps only the latest record per key, which is all the downstream reconciler in the Havener cluster needs. Verify disk usage drops within an hour; if it doesn't, check the cleaner thread logs. Once compaction is confirmed, sign the deploy manifest so the next maintainer can trust this configuration. The signing key is as follows.

release key, fajef-kajeg: bky19_LdLu6Ne6FLi8he2c24d

Subject: Kiosk watchdog — context for review and on-call

Welcome aboard. The Brightstall kiosk app runs a watchdog that restarts the UI process if the heartbeat file goes stale for 90 seconds. When reviewing changes, flag anything that blocks the main loop, since that trips restarts in the field and pages whoever's on call. Overnight restarts are expected during content sync; repeated daytime restarts are not. Watchdog internals, log locations, and the escalation path are documented here.

runbook for badug-kadup: https://confluence.zemvarlabs.internal/projects/browse/display/projects/bd1b

**Ticket: AddressPilot widget acting weird on staging**

Hey folks — the AddressPilot autocomplete on the Quellford storefront is suggesting results from the wrong region again. Looks like classic config drift: someone hot-patched staging last sprint and it never got synced back. Prod and staging now disagree on at least three settings, so please don't "fix" anything by copying blindly. For reference, here's what staging is currently running with.

settings of tajof-fajep:
BRIWYN_PIN=8552
BRIWYN_TENANT=istion
BRIWYN_METRICS_HOST=metrics.briwyn.olvarqlabs.test
BRIWYN_SEAL=seal_46778c01
BRIWYN_STANDBY_TEAM=silok

## Reception Desk Move — Ground Floor

Heads up, facilities folks: reception at Marlow Point is moving from mezzanine down to the ground floor this Thursday. Expect a bit of chaos — deliveries should be redirected to the new desk by the revolving doors, and the mezzanine counter gets decommissioned Friday. Visitor sign-in stays on the tablets, same as before. To open the new desk's secure drawer and barrier controls, use the code below.

badge for fafop-fajof: bdg-Z-47